    Official P67A/Z68X-UD7 Owner's Club + Discussion



    From The MOST in Depth Preview/Review P67A-UD7
    Some highlights include the VRM/PMW design (power delivery), and I go very in depth about the advantages and disadvantages of Analogue VS Digital VRM design. BIOS section including brand new BIOS settings including wattage and amperage to the implementation of EFI BIOS in the future. The USB 3.0 sub-system on this board is phenomenal tree type system along with SATA6G connectivity this board can power all of your devices to their fullest extent, and when you have all the SATA and USB ports filled you can enable USB 3.0 Turbo Mode to add speed and bandwidth. I take apart of the cooling on this board and put it to the test to find out how well it transfers and dissipates heat in the motherboard cooling section. I then take a look at both PCI-E busses in the NF200 and PCH P67 section, and analyze the benefits.

    Features:
    24 phase power for over 1300 watts output
    32MBit BIOS for future EFI BIOS
    NF200 directly to CPU PCI-E lanes for SLI
    Separate PCI-E bus for peripherals so no bottleneck SLI
    Sleek Black NO Brown through Matte PCB
    Extensive USB3.0 system with USB 3.0 Turbo(bypass DMI by CPU PCI-E lanes)

    On the P55 you could set the power (wattage) and current (amperage) limits through software but for the UD6 at least this wasn't really necessary as Gig set the current reported to the CPU through hardware mod to somewhere around a fixed ~24A IIRC. This meant even if your OC'd board was pulling over 100A the CPU would still think it was only using 24A and under the TDC therefore not throttle. Also because the current measurement is part of the power measurement the TDP limit would not be tripped either.

    So I guess now with the newer boards you now will have to set these limits to take advantage of TDP and TDC limiting, especially on the unlocked k series CPUs which use turbo bins as the unlocked multiplier.

    TDP = Thermal Design Power
    TDC = Thermal Design Current

    RealTemp 3.60 and ThrottleStop let you adjust the turbo TDP/TDC limits on the Intel processors that are unlocked like the Extreme and K series. Both programs are available here on XS.

    This feature has made a huge difference to the performance of the 920XM and 940XM mobile CPUs. Increasing these limits results in more turbo boost when fully loaded with less turbo throttling. Intel has made some changes to Sandy Bridge but being able to adjust turbo TDP/TDC might become a very useful feature on the new Sandy Bridge K series CPUs.
